Barry Sanders, one of the most electrifying running backs in NFL history, is renowned for his exceptional agility and ability to evade defenders. His playing style has left a lasting impact on how modern running backs approach the game.
Barry Sanders’ Unique Playing Style
Sanders was known for his quick cuts, elusive moves, and exceptional balance. His ability to change direction rapidly allowed him to break through defenses that seemed impenetrable. His agility was not just about speed but also about the precision of his movements, making him a nightmare for defenders.
Impact on Contemporary Running Backs
Many modern running backs have modeled their playing style after Sanders. They focus on developing agility and evasive skills to maximize their effectiveness on the field. This shift has led to a more dynamic and exciting style of play in the NFL.
Key Traits Inspired by Sanders
- Quick Direction Changes: Emulating Sanders’ ability to pivot swiftly to evade tackles.
- Balance and Control: Maintaining stability during rapid movements.
- Elusive Moves: Incorporating spins, jukes, and cuts to deceive defenders.
Conclusion
Barry Sanders’ agility set a new standard for running backs, emphasizing the importance of quickness, balance, and evasiveness. His influence continues to shape the training and playing styles of contemporary NFL athletes, making the game more exciting for fans and more challenging for defenders.
